In the early '70s, Alaska Methodist University contracted with the federal and state
governments to provide certain educational services that were carried out by AMU faculty
and staff on an uncompensated overload basis. Since all of these called for travel
to Bush communities and Air Force remote sites, Margritt Engel volunteered to participate.
Everyone is invited to hear Margritt Engel, Professor Emerita in the UAA Languages Department, share her stories and photographs about rural Alaska in the '70s.
